Transaction efc7d49140ec752aed9312a071a1bf0baa592c74f62670b4fd33ccceebc36673

2 Input
1 Outputs
  • efc7d49140ec752aed9312a071a1bf0baa592c74f62670b4fd33ccceebc36673:0
  • value  10965053
    address  1QHLWwDw5FRaL2vGRyFRa9QMbwbzEbDb1B